How will media be delt with by law in the future?

I believe that in the future, the law will try to reduce the number of hours people are exposed to various types of media. As many people have concerns about young people being influenced by violent media, I believe that this will be top priority to be combatted. The average time spent using media by teenagers today is 30-40 hours a week... I believe that in the future this will be reduced and/or monitored by the law in order to prevent impressionable people from being influenced by the media and to stop young people accessing types of media that they should not be.

How can Human Traffic be a metaphor for the effects model?

The effects model, also known as the hypodermic model, sees the audience as duped and doped. Media is 'injected' into the audience, much like drugs are injected by addicts... This theory suggests that we simply lay back and accept the media as it is presented to us, much like when someone takes drugs. Drug taking is a strong and prominent theme in Human Traffic as many of the main characters talk about the drugs they take. Therefore, the film Human Traffic can itself be a metaphor for the Hypodermic Model as they both relate to drug taking.
